Forward trace properties

I'm just wondering what protocols are being followed for the forward trace properties? Are they under movement control? Thanks.

Traced property’s are not under movement control.
They are managed by their risk factor ie: how close to a movement control property are they even before they are tested, then they test high risk farms first and as the results comes though their risk goes up or down if they go up they may go to a movement control NOD were movement is restricted, if there is a possibility of a positive they go to RPI were no movement is aloud expected for to cull, when they get a positive they become an IP and a cull order follows.
